UofM Vocal Arts Area Coordinator launches “The Balanced Singer” podcast

Dr. Kyle Ferrill, associate professor of voice with the Rudi E. Scheidt School of Music, launched The Balanced Singer Podcast earlier this summer. The podcast, which promises to bring insights from yoga, meditation, Buddhism, habit formation and more to the practices of singing and the teaching of singing, grew as…
